Subject: Pool car keys — how it works

Hi there, and welcome to Tarnwell Group!

If you need one of the pool cars, the keys live in the grey cabinet just behind reception. Book the car first on the intranet (honestly, people forget), then sign the key out in the logbook so we know who's got what. The cabinet has a keypad lock, and the current code is below.

door code, yagap-bahof: bdg-O-05

## Deploy Step 4: Catalog Cache Invalidation

Gristmill's product catalog caches listing pages for 15 minutes. After deploying price or taxonomy changes, run `gristctl cache purge --scope catalog` before the smoke test, or reviewers will see stale prices and fail the check. Partial purges by SKU are fine for hotfixes; full purges during peak hours need sign-off from the on-call. The purge command talks to the cache coordinator over its admin port and reads credentials from the deploy env file, which must contain the coordinator secret:

sealed setting: RELAY_SECRET13=bca49b02a6971

# MAX_LAYER_SIZE_MB governs the Trimhaven image slimmer.
# Layers above this threshold are split and re-compressed, which
# can confuse support tickets about "missing" layers — they are
# merged at pull time, nothing is lost. Raising this value requires
# a platform review. The slimmer build that set the current value
# is identified by the token below.

session token of tajef-bageg = htk21_5d90d574934f3ccae6437